Key Elements of a Professional Letter Requesting Payment Terms
When drafting a professional letter requesting a payment date and terms, there are several key elements to include:
- Clear Request: Clearly state that you are requesting a payment and specify the amount due.
- Payment Terms: Outline the proposed payment terms, including the due date, payment methods, and any late payment fees.
- Invoice Details: Include details of the invoice, such as the invoice number and date.
- Contact Information: Provide your contact information for any questions or concerns.
By including these elements, your professional letter requesting a payment date and terms will be comprehensive and effective.

Sample of a Professional Letter Requesting Payment Terms
Here is a sample professional letter requesting a payment date and terms:
[Your Company Logo]
[Your Company Name]
[Your Company Address]
[City, State, ZIP]
[Date]
[Recipient’s Name]
[Recipient’s Title]
[Client’s Company Name]
[Client’s Company Address]
[City, State, ZIP]
Dear [Recipient’s Name],
Re: Professional Letter Requesting a Payment Date and Terms for Invoice [Invoice Number]
I am writing to request a payment for the services rendered as outlined in our agreement dated [Date of Agreement]. The total amount due is $[Amount], as per the invoice [Invoice Number] dated [Invoice Date].
We would like to propose the following payment terms:
– Payment due date: [Due Date]
– Payment methods: Bank transfer, check, or credit card
– Late payment fee: 2% per month
Please find the invoice attached for your reference. If you have any questions or concerns regarding this invoice or the proposed payment terms, please do not hesitate to contact me directly.
Thank you for your prompt attention to this matter. We appreciate your business and look forward to continuing our relationship.
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
[Your Title]
[Your Contact Information]
This sample letter demonstrates how to effectively request payment terms in a professional manner.
Best Practices for Sending Professional Letters Requesting Payment Terms
When sending a professional letter requesting a payment date and terms, consider the following best practices:
| Best Practice | Description |
|---|---|
| Use a Professional Format | Ensure that your letter is formatted professionally, with a formal font and layout. |
| Send via Trackable Method | Send your letter via a trackable method, such as certified mail or email with a delivery receipt. |
| Keep a Record | Keep a record of all correspondence, including the letter and any responses. |
By following these best practices, you can ensure that your professional letter requesting a payment date and terms is received and acted upon.
